面向服务器的AWS架构 - >工作者

时间:2017-04-26 21:02:54

标签: amazon-web-services architecture web-worker

我不知道如何在AWS上设置我的架构。

这是我想要的:

用户可以生成查询并将其发送到Web服务器,后者将此查询委派给特定的工作者。这个工人开始一个大的过程,可能需要很多时间并产生输出。此输出应对用户可读。此外,应该可以取消正在运行的进程。这有点棘手,因为一次只有一个工人。所以我需要像所有人一样广播。

我在考虑ElasticBeanstalk,但我不知道如何将输出提供给用户以及cancle的东西。

我希望有人可以告诉我,我知道在AWS中构建它的好方法。

1 个答案:

答案 0 :(得分:0)

Autoscaling组中的SQS + S3 + EC2可能就是你想要的。

请查看one of the AWS reference architectures以了解此类情况。

enter image description here